Aktueller Inhalt von TB-UB

  • Ab sofort steht euch hier im Forum die neue Add-on Verwaltung zur Verfügung – eine zentrale Plattform für alles rund um Erweiterungen und Add-ons für den DSM.

    Damit haben wir einen Ort, an dem Lösungen von Nutzern mit der Community geteilt werden können. Über die Team Funktion können Projekte auch gemeinsam gepflegt werden.

    Was die Add-on Verwaltung kann und wie es funktioniert findet Ihr hier

    Hier geht es zu den Add-ons

  1. T

    jarss – (just another rsync shell script)

    Genau an dieser Stelle (wo das target um datetime ergänzt wurde Z297; was nur im Fall incremental="true" passiert) ist es eben so, dass nun das neue target (das nach Zeile 257 nocheinmal verändert wurde) keinen slash mehr am Ende hat. Deshalb könnte man wie von mir vorgeschlagen in Z297 dafür...
  2. T

    jarss – (just another rsync shell script)

    Noch ein kleines finding (für alle die das script mit den unterschiedlichen Fällen verstehen wollen und so wie ich das Ausführungs-log durchschauen und sich fragen, weshalb da an einer Stelle ein slash mehrl oder an anderer Stelle weniger ist). Die Zeile 369: echo...
  3. T

    jarss – (just another rsync shell script)

    Falls ihr auch noch an das gute allte TimeBackup zurückdenkt.... Es schaut fast so aus, als wäre das Ergebnis..... mit den Einstellungen recycle="99999" incremental="true" versions="99999" und einer kleinen Formatänderung im script Zeile 155: statt date +"%Y-%m-%d %H:%M:%S"...
  4. T

    jarss – (just another rsync shell script)

    Also wirklich nochmal Hut ab, ich versteh das script ja noch nicht wiklich. Das mit dem synchron/inkrement/rotate/--link-dest/rm -rf/ln -s usw..., da muss ich mich nochmal reinfuchsen. U.a. bei den Bedingungen bei den if's ist mir nicht klar, weshalb mal 2 Paar eckige Klammern gebraucht...
  5. T

    nur noch eine weitere "Strategie" für Versionierung im Backup (mit rsync und cp und Snapshot-Replication)

    Nach guten 3 Jahren muss ich meine "Strategie" leider als gescheitert ansehen. Ich bin noch forschen, woran es liegen könnte, dass pro Sicherungsjob mittlerweile bis zu 200 GB neu belegt werden (ohne dass entsprechend neue Dateien angelegt wurden). Nun läuft mein Volume voll. Meine Verutung...
  6. T

    jarss – (just another rsync shell script)

    Danke, die Änderungen hören sich gut an. Habe jetzt die neue Version -200 noch nicht wirklich ausprobiert (weil ich die -100 bereits an meine Bedrürfnisse angepasst habe). Nur ein erster gefundener möglicher Minibug der -200: in Zeile 105 des jarss.sh scheint ein txt_re am Textanfang zu fehlen...
  7. T

    Snapshot Replication: einzelne Dateien aus allen Snapshots löschen

    Nun habe ich eine Anleitung gefunden, wie das theoretisch gehen kann: https://www.reddit.com/r/synology/comments/d1id10/psa_you_actually_can_delete_individual_files_from/ (die Seite habe ich auch kurz auf Deutsch gesehen, habe mir aber den Link nicht gemerkt und jetzt finde ich diese nicht...
  8. T

    jarss – (just another rsync shell script)

    ... da war ich dann wohl zu spät und DaveR hat das besser gemacht als ich es tun hätte können, da ich kein ionice habe. Wollte hiermit nur kurz auf die Anfrage von oben antworten, um Respekt zu zollen. Nochmal danke für die neue Version von jarss.
  9. T

    jarss – (just another rsync shell script)

    ps: Tommes, Dein Video zu "SSH Public Key Verbindung zu einem Synology NAS einrichten" https://www.youtube.com/watch?v=VjoWjX_8E3Q ist absolut toll gemacht. Vielleicht trau ich mich mit dieser Anleitung auch mal zu das mit RSA anzugehen.
  10. T

    jarss – (just another rsync shell script)

    Habe nochmal über diese Zeile zu a) nachgedacht (versucht nachzudenken ;o) if ! command -v . ./ionice 2>&1 >/dev/null; then Was auch immer da am Ende mit stdout und stderr gemacht wird, ich bin mir nicht sicher ob die zwei Punkte nicht ein logisches Oder darstellen und da für den ersten . immer...
  11. T

    jarss – (just another rsync shell script)

    Danke für die schnelle Antwort und dass Du Dir das anschauen möchtest. Nur um sicher zu gehen, dass wir uns nicht missverstehen: zu a) ja, das ist ja das "komische", dass die Vorbelegung von ionice in Zeile 346 bzw 357 erfolgt (weil die Logik anscheinend "sagt" ionice wäre gefunden, aber unten...
  12. T

    jarss – (just another rsync shell script)

    Danke für dieses script, ist mal wieder sehr hilfreich. (Ich bin jetzt nicht DER scrip-Schreiber, schon gar nicht mit ellenlangen Zeilen). Ein paar Hinweise (keine Wünsche oder so), deren Berücksichtigung evtl weiteren Nutzern das Leben einfacher machen könnten. a) Die Zeile 386 (${ionice} \)...